Hotel highlights booked for Saadiyat


The luxury St Regis hotel, being developed by TDIC, and the Dh1 billion (US$272.2 million) Park Hyatt resort, which is owned by Abu Dhabi National Hotels, are scheduled to open next month.

Nine hotels were planned for the Saadiyat Island beach district, including a Shangri-La, Rotana and a Mandarin Oriental.

Those hotels, some of which are being built by third-party developers, have been delayed or put on hold. TDIC said it was reluctant to put more properties into the market at the moment to compete with the St Regis.
